Rottenmann
Town
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Rottenmann is a town in Styria in Austria, near the Rottenmanner Tauern. Rottenmann was first referred to in a document in 927. It received its town charter in 1279 from King Rudolf von Habsburg.
Oppenberg
Hamlet
Photo: PLauppert,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Oppenberg is a former municipality in the district of Liezen in Styria, Austria. Since the 2015 Styria municipal structural reform, it is part of the municipality Rottenmann. Oppenberg is situated 7 km southwest of Strechaubach.
